What are Flange Insulation Gasket Kits and Why Are They Critical?

In industries ranging from oil and gas to chemical processing and power generation, pipeline integrity is non-negotiable. A primary threat to this integrity is galvanic corrosion, an electrochemical process that occurs when dissimilar metals in a piping system are connected and exposed to an electrolyte. This corrosion can lead to catastrophic failures, unplanned downtime, and significant financial loss. This is where the specialized role of Flange Insulation Gasket Kits becomes indispensable. These kits are engineered to break the electrical continuity in a flanged connection, effectively stopping the flow of stray electrical currents that cause corrosion. Unlike a standard gasket, a complete insulation kit provides a comprehensive barrier, protecting both the flange faces and the bolting from becoming a pathway for corrosion.

Detailed Product Specifications of Kaxite Sealing Insulation Kits

Our Kaxite Sealing Flange Insulation Gasket Kits are systematically designed to provide complete isolation. Each kit typically includes the following high-performance components:

  • Central Insulating Gasket: The core sealing and isolating element, placed between the flange faces.
  • Insulating Washers/Sleeves: Fit around the studs or bolts to prevent them from contacting the flange holes.
  • Insulating Washers: Placed under the nuts (and sometimes under the bolt heads) to isolate the bolting from the flange.
  • Steel Washers: Used in conjunction with insulating washers to distribute the load and prevent over-compression of the insulating material.
  • Alignment Tools/Pins (for specific kits): Ensure perfect alignment of the gasket and insulating components during assembly, crucial for maintaining an even seal.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Flange Insulation Gasket Kits

General Application & Selection

Q: When is a Flange Insulation Gasket Kit required?

A: A kit is essential in any flanged connection where dissimilar metals are joined (e.g., carbon steel to stainless steel) or where the pipeline is susceptible to stray current interference. Common applications include: cathodic protection test points, insulating pipeline sections at compressor/pump stations, isolating offshore platforms from subsea pipelines, protecting above-ground pipelines at support points, and isolating equipment like heat exchangers or vessels where galvanic cells can form.

Q: Can I just use an insulating gasket without the full kit of washers and sleeves?

A: No, this is a critical mistake. Using only the gasket fails to provide complete isolation. The bolts or studs will create a metal-to-metal contact between the two flanges, forming a perfect electrical bridge that nullifies the gasket's insulating effect. The full Kaxite Sealing kit is required to ensure every potential electrical path is broken.

Q: How do I select the right material for my insulation kit?

A: Material selection is based on three primary factors: Service Temperature, Chemical Media, and Pressure. For high-temperature, high-pressure chemical lines, PTFE-based gaskets with phenolic washers are typically chosen. For lower-temperature water or steam lines, elastomeric gaskets may be suitable. Always consult the Kaxite Sealing technical datasheets and consider factors like pH, presence of hydrocarbons, and expected thermal cycling. Installation & Performance

Q: What are the key steps for correctly installing a Kaxite Sealing insulation kit?

A: Proper installation is paramount. Key steps include: 1) Thoroughly clean and inspect both flange faces for damage. 2) Ensure the flange faces are dry and free of conductive debris. 3) Slide insulating sleeves onto each bolt/stud. 4) Place the insulating gasket carefully between the flange faces, using alignment pins if provided. 5) Insert the sleeved bolts through the flange holes. 6) On the nut side, stack a steel washer followed by an insulating washer before tightening the nut. 7) Use a calibrated torque wrench to tighten bolts in a star-pattern sequence to the recommended torque value to ensure even compression without damaging the insulating components.

Q: How do I test if an installed insulation kit is working effectively?

A: Insulation resistance should be verified after installation. Using a low-resistance ohmmeter (megger), measure the resistance across the isolated flange joint. A reading of greater than 1 megohm (1,000,000 Ω) typically indicates good isolation. Regular testing as part of a maintenance schedule is recommended to ensure ongoing protection, as contamination or moisture ingress can degrade performance over time.

Q: What is the typical lifespan of an insulation kit, and what causes failure?

A: The lifespan varies greatly with service conditions but a properly selected and installed Kaxite Sealing kit can last for many years, often over a decade in stable environments. Common failure modes include: improper installation (over-torquing, misalignment), exposure to temperatures or chemicals beyond the material's rating, physical damage during service, and compression set or creep of the gasket material over time under sustained load. Using our high-performance materials like modified PTFE minimizes creep-related failures.
